After narrowing the Season 3 nominations to a short list of 10 towns, Deluxe visited each of the towns and identified five
finalists:
- Alton, Illinois – A riverfront community separated from Missouri and the St. Louis metro area
by the Mighty Mississippi, this bustling town once boasted more millionaires per capita than anywhere in the U.S. Now, Alton is
transitioning out of its heavily industrial past and is in the midst of an entrepreneurial reinvention.
- Amesbury, Massachusetts – A historic New England town that was once famous for manufacturing
everything from ships to carriages. Nestled on the Merrimack River, Amesbury now features a picturesque downtown that is filled
with inspiring small businesses.
- Bastrop, Texas – A small community outside of Austin that has weathered challenges that
include a massive forest fire. Its downtown, which feels plucked from a classic Western film, features everything from a
moonshine distiller to an arts bazaar selling high-end Persian rugs.
- Martinez, California – The only town that can claim to be the home of both Joe DiMaggio and
the martini, Martinez sits on the outskirts of San Francisco’s East Bay. Its downtown is experiencing a revival amid the
renovation of beautiful historic buildings.
- Siloam Springs, Arkansas – Located in the northwestern corner of the state on the Oklahoma
border, Siloam Springs blends a wealth of natural beauty with a youthful entrepreneurial enthusiasm and a robust Hispanic
community. The passion their business owners have for the place they live and work is immediately evident.

Deluxe debuted the Small Business Revolution in 2015 to celebrate a century of providing marketing and other services to small
businesses and financial institutions. The campaign started by telling 100 stories of small businesses across
the country. In doing so, Deluxe found a need to support and celebrate small towns that originally inspired the Small
Business Revolution – Main Street and its $500,000 boost. The first two seasons of the show can be seen at SmallBusinessRevolution.org.
